How much does it cost to rent an apartment in East Midway?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
East Midway Studio Apartments | $1,151 | $695 | $3,768 |
East Midway 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,552 | $850 | $5,940 |
East Midway 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,946 | $785 | $10,000+ |
East Midway 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,458 | $1,525 | $3,965 |
East Midway 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,820 | $1,800 | $3,200 |

Getting Around the East Midway Neighborhood in Saint Paul, MN
Walk Score®
69 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
74 / 100
Very Bikeable
Biking is convenient for most trips
Transit Score®
45 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
